在PHP中,获取当前时间的整数表示通常是指获取当前的Unix时间戳。Unix时间戳是从1970年1月1日(UTC/GMT的午夜)开始所经过的秒数,不包括闰秒。
在PHP中,可以使用time()
函数来获取当前的Unix时间戳。
<?php
$current_timestamp = time();
echo $current_timestamp;
?>
原因:
解决方法:
date_default_timezone_set()
函数设置正确的时区。<?php
date_default_timezone_set('Asia/Shanghai'); // 设置时区为上海
$current_timestamp = time();
echo $current_timestamp;
?>
解决方法:
microtime()
函数,它可以返回当前Unix时间戳和微秒数。<?php
$microtime = microtime(true);
echo $microtime;
?>
通过以上信息,你应该能够理解PHP中如何获取当前时间的整数表示,以及相关的优势和可能遇到的问题。
领取专属 10元无门槛券
手把手带您无忧上云